Do not configure provider for stonith ra
Closes-bug: #1515919 Change-Id: Ife8cecd13a4232db0df621c73963605a6b217213 Signed-off-by: Bogdan Dobrelya <bdobrelia@mirantis.com>
This commit is contained in:
parent
231addb8bf
commit
1dffa5e758
|
@ -44,7 +44,8 @@ define pcs_fencing::fencing (
|
||||||
|
|
||||||
cs_resource { $res_name:
|
cs_resource { $res_name:
|
||||||
ensure => present,
|
ensure => present,
|
||||||
provided_by => 'pacemaker',
|
# stonith does not support providers
|
||||||
|
provided_by => undef,
|
||||||
primitive_class => 'stonith',
|
primitive_class => 'stonith',
|
||||||
primitive_type => $agent_type,
|
primitive_type => $agent_type,
|
||||||
parameters => $parameters,
|
parameters => $parameters,
|
||||||
|
|
|
@ -16,7 +16,7 @@ describe 'pcs_fencing::fencing', :type => :define do
|
||||||
let :primitive_params do
|
let :primitive_params do
|
||||||
{
|
{
|
||||||
:ensure => 'present',
|
:ensure => 'present',
|
||||||
:provided_by => 'pacemaker',
|
:provided_by => nil,
|
||||||
:primitive_class => 'stonith',
|
:primitive_class => 'stonith',
|
||||||
:primitive_type => params[:agent_type],
|
:primitive_type => params[:agent_type],
|
||||||
:parameters => params[:parameters],
|
:parameters => params[:parameters],
|
||||||
|
@ -40,7 +40,7 @@ describe 'pcs_fencing::fencing', :type => :define do
|
||||||
["expressions", [
|
["expressions", [
|
||||||
{"attribute"=>"#uname",
|
{"attribute"=>"#uname",
|
||||||
"operation"=>"ne",
|
"operation"=>"ne",
|
||||||
"value"=>"node-1"}]]]
|
"value"=>"node-1"}]]]
|
||||||
}
|
}
|
||||||
end
|
end
|
||||||
let(:facts) {{ :osfamily => 'Debian' }}
|
let(:facts) {{ :osfamily => 'Debian' }}
|
||||||
|
|
Loading…
Reference in New Issue